    Slaying of Joshua Brown, Botham Jean's neighbor, draws widespread speculation but few details from police

    The timing of Brown's death has raised questions about whether the shooting was tied to his testimony during Amber Guyger's murder trial


    News that Joshua Brown, a key witness in Amber Guyger's murder trial, was fatally shot Friday night drew national interest and concern, as it was only Wednesday that jurors had sent her to prison for 10 years. But two days after Brown's slaying, Dallas police had released little information about their investigation of his death.
    The Police Department confirmed Sunday afternoon that the 28-year-old Brown was the victim whom officers found about 10:30 p.m. Friday with multiple gunshot wounds to his lower body. Police spokesman Sgt. Warren Mitchell said Saturday, before Brown had been publicly identified, that the victim died at Parkland Memorial Hospital.
    The timing of Brown's death has raised public speculation about whether the shooting was tied to his testimony.
    Read more: Botham Jean's neighbor, a key witness in Amber Guyger trial, shot to death in Dallas
    Against the backdrop of swift social media reaction to the news of BrownÂ’s death, DallasÂ’ elected leaders, including Mayor Eric Johnson, urged patience as the investigation plays out.


    In a statement Sunday afternoon on Twitter, Johnson said he trusts the Police Department to investigate thoroughly.
